Volkswagen sales in China hit a record 1.4m vehicles in 2009 – up almost 37% over the previous year – in what has now become its most important market.

A company statement described 2009 as “an extraordinary year” when the market in China went “beyond everybody’s expectations”.
The group sold 1.12m VW brand cars in China, nearly 159,000 Audi models and 122,500 Skodas. It also sold 600 ‘supercars’ in China, including 484 Bentleys and 118 Lamborghinis.
Winfried Vahland, president and chief executive of Volkswagen Group China, said: “We are full of confidence for 2010 (and) expecting a growth rate of 10 to 15% for the total automotive market in China.”
